2 pages side by side on landscape, a must for pdf.




_______
multiple columns per page, at least 3 (better 4) on landscape and 2 (better up to 3) on portrait, similar to scientific pdf papers for epub and maybe reflow pdf



___

For me this is a must, I can't use neo reader without this features at all, it is a waste of space of the screen. You end up with ultra giant fonts for blind people or with tiny fonts but every line so wide that it's easy to lose it when moving to the next or trying to read fast.

When you can use columns, you don't need to move the eyes on the same line, with a fixed eye you can read a whole line and move to the next one much more efficiently.

Also, 2 pages for pdf in landscape with this screen is perfect and help us to avoid going back and forward so much when reading some technical pdf where you are referenced to other lines, pictures or graphs on the next page or the previous one.
